Overview

""Personal and Community Health"" is an authoritative examination of health practices and public safety measures designed to foster well-being across all levels of society. Authored by health education expert Clair Elsmere Turner, the book provides a dual-focused approach to maintaining vitality and preventing illness. The first portion of the work addresses personal hygiene, offering insights into nutrition, respiratory health, nervous system function, and the importance of mental health in daily life. The latter portion transitions to the broader scope of community health, detailing the scientific and administrative efforts required to manage sanitation, ensure food safety, and control the spread of infection within populations. Through a blend of biological principles and social responsibility, ""Personal and Community Health"" emphasizes the interconnectedness of individual habits and collective welfare. This foundational text remains a significant historical reference for understanding the evolution of health standards and the development of modern public health infrastructure. It serves as an essential resource for those interested in the historical foundations of preventive medicine and the history of medicine.
